Sope Aluko To Unveil New Short Film ‘Chidera’ At AFRIFF

November 2, 2023
Black Panther Actress Sope Aluko Unveils 'Chidera' At AFRIFF

Acclaimed actress, writer, and emerging filmmaker Sope Aluko is poised to unveil her inaugural short film, “Chidera,” at the prestigious Africa International Film Festival (AFRIFF).

“Chidera” is a poignant and emotionally charged cinematic gem that delves into the intricacies of identity, heritage, and self-discovery within the framework of a contemporary Nigerian-American immigrant community.

At its core, the film tells the story of a high school teenager named Chidera, who grapples with the complexities of her cultural heritage and the expectations placed upon her by her family and community.

As Chidera embarks on a deeply personal journey towards self-acceptance, the short film takes viewers on an evocative and visually stunning cinematic odyssey.

Sope Aluko, the celebrated Nigerian-born, British-American actress renowned for her roles in Hollywood blockbusters such as “Black Panther,” “Wakanda Forever,” and “Venom,” has seamlessly transitioned into a storyteller’s role with “Chidera.”

Her film serves as a testament to her passion for authentic storytelling and her unwavering commitment to showcasing the rich tapestry and diversity of her Nigerian heritage.

In 2019, Sope Aluko established her production company, “SopeBox Productions,” with a compelling mission: to amplify positive and empowering stories about the African Diaspora, particularly female-driven narratives that showcase the indomitable spirit of African women like her late mother and other unsung heroines of their time.

The inclusion of “Chidera” in the AFRIFF lineup represents a significant milestone for Sope Aluko and her production team. AFRIFF is a renowned platform for celebrating and promoting both African and international cinema.

Its selection of “Chidera” underscores the exceptional quality of Aluko’s work and her unwavering dedication to crafting thought-provoking and compelling films.

Expressing her enthusiasm about the upcoming screening, Sope Aluko stated, “Chidera is a project very close to my heart. It’s crucial to employ film as a medium to illuminate vital social issues and empower our youth.

This short film encapsulates the message of resilience, self-love, and embracing one’s identity, and I can’t wait to share it with the world at AFRIFF.”

In a world where identity and self-acceptance continue to be vital themes, “Chidera” promises to be a powerful and captivating exploration of these issues, as Sope Aluko shines a light on the importance of embracing one’s heritage, culture, and, ultimately, one’s true self.
